## Configuration

Quick heads-up for reviewers: Driftgauge exists because our build agents disagree about what time it is, and artifact timestamps were a mess. The env file sets `MAX_SKEW_MS` (default 1500) and `SYNC_SOURCE`, which should be the Pellman time service in every region. Don't bump the skew ceiling to hide a broken agent — fix the agent. The token Driftgauge uses to query agents goes on the next line.

env line for fafof-fahag: LEDGER_TOKEN5=f8790

**TICKET: Broker upgrade blocked — config vault locked**

Upgrading Quillbus from 4.x to 5.x for plugin authors. Migration script needs the broker credentials vault, which auto-locked after three failed attempts. Plugin compatibility tests are paused until it reopens. External authors: do not republish plugins against 4.x in the meantime. Unlock the vault with the recovery passphrase below.

vault phrase of kawep-tahog = ulaix-briath

Subject: Cron-to-Flowline cut-over summary

As of Monday, all nightly cron jobs on the Barrowfield hosts run under Flowline. Each job was converted to a workflow with retries, alerting, and run-history retention. The legacy crontabs were emptied, not deleted, so rollback stays trivial for two weeks. No missed runs were observed during the overlap window. Flowline now operates with the following configuration.

settings of kagag-kagef:
[kelath]
port = 9300
region = west-4
host = kelath.olvarqworks.example
team = sorion
timeout_ms = 1000
retries = 8

For board consideration: the Corvane instrument line has held list prices for six quarters while input costs rose roughly 7%. We propose a tiered increase of 3–5% effective next quarter, sheltering the entry model to protect volume in the Delworth channel. Competitor movement from Halberly Systems suggests headroom exists. Sensitivity modelling indicates margin recovery within two quarters at conservative attach rates. We ask the board to approve the tier structure as drafted. One confidential consideration follows.

management briefing: Headcount on the Quenael team goes from 9 to 80 by the end of July. Gross margin on Quenael came in at 15 percent against a plan of 20 percent.